Choosing the Right Greenery Style

Define Your Event Theme

Before selecting materials, consider your event’s theme and color palette. A rustic wedding pairs well with eucalyptus and ivy. A modern celebration may call for structured boxwood panels. Tropical parties benefit from palm leaves and monstera plants.

Your greenery backdrop should complement the overall décor, not overpower it. Harmony is key. Think about the mood you want to create. Romantic. Minimal. Luxurious. The greenery should reflect that atmosphere.

Fresh vs Artificial Greenery

Fresh greenery offers natural fragrance and organic movement. However, it requires proper hydration and installation close to the event time. Artificial greenery is durable, reusable, and easier to manage. High-quality faux panels can look surprisingly realistic and photograph beautifully.

Choose based on budget, climate, and event duration. Both options can deliver stunning results when styled properly.

Planning the Structure and Layout

Select the Right Frame

A sturdy frame is essential for a professional finish. Popular choices include metal arches, wooden frames, freestanding panels, or pipe-and-drape systems. The structure should match the size of your venue and the number of guests.

For intimate events, a small circular or rectangular backdrop works well. Larger weddings may require a full greenery wall for dramatic impact.

Balance and Dimension

Flat greenery panels can look elegant, but adding dimension elevates the design. Layer different types of leaves. Incorporate hanging vines for depth. Consider asymmetrical arrangements for a modern look.

Spacing matters. Avoid overcrowding the frame. Leave room for accents such as signage, neon lights, or floral clusters. A balanced composition ensures the backdrop remains visually appealing from every angle.

Adding Decorative Elements

Incorporate Florals and Lighting

Florals soften the greenery and add color. White roses create a romantic vibe. Bright blooms add energy to birthday or engagement parties. Even small floral accents can dramatically enhance the design.

Lighting also plays a crucial role. String lights, fairy lights, or spotlights highlight textures and create warmth. Soft, diffused lighting works best for photography.

Personalization and Signage

Custom signs make the greenery backdrop more meaningful. Add the couple’s initials, a wedding hashtag, or a celebratory phrase. Acrylic signs, wooden lettering, or neon displays are popular choices.

Personal touches turn a simple greenery wall into a memorable centerpiece. Guests will naturally gather around it for photos, increasing its visual impact throughout the event.

Placement and Practical Considerations

Choose the Ideal Location

Position your greenery backdrop where it draws attention without blocking movement. Behind the head table, ceremony altar, dessert station, or photo booth area are excellent options.

Ensure there is enough space for guests to stand comfortably in front of it. Adequate lighting and accessibility are essential for safety and functionality.

Weather and Maintenance

For outdoor events, consider wind and sunlight. Secure the frame properly and avoid direct harsh sunlight that may wilt fresh greenery. For indoor venues, check height restrictions and fire safety guidelines if using lighting.

Preparation prevents last-minute stress. A well-installed greenery backdrop should remain stable and vibrant throughout the celebration.

FAQs

Q1 What is the best greenery for wedding backdrops?

Eucalyptus, ivy, boxwood panels, and ferns are popular choices. The best option depends on your theme and budget.

Q2 How much does a greenery backdrop cost?

Costs vary based on size, materials, and customization. Artificial panels are often more affordable and reusable, while fresh greenery may increase expenses.

Q3 Can I create a DIY greenery backdrop?

Yes. With a sturdy frame, greenery panels, zip ties, and decorative accents, you can design a beautiful DIY backdrop. Planning and patience are key.

Q4 How far in advance should it be installed?

Artificial backdrops can be installed a day before the event. Fresh greenery should be set up as close to the event time as possible to maintain freshness.

Q5 Are greenery backdrops suitable for small venues?

Absolutely. Compact designs or partial greenery arches work perfectly in smaller spaces without overwhelming the room.
